There's More To Know Before Buying Any Fence
It's pretty hard to take your fence back after you have bought it and it's in the ground, right? You need to have some guidelines to follow so you can make the best decision, and of course price is a factor and you need to stay in your budget. And it's not always easy to visualize how it will look after it's installed. So now you have a better appreciation for what's involved with purchasing your new fence, and here are some tips to assist you.
It's a good idea to have the resale value in mind that a good, high quality fence can provide, but not all fences will significantly add anything to the future selling price. A plain old fence is fine, but a fence that is attractive and adds a nice view to see will do more for you. And if you are concerned about security for your garden and home, then think about combining that plus aesthetics. From choosing the right fence made from quality materials to complying with appropriate local laws, there's a lot for you to know.
You can avoid future headaches by knowing what your rights are as a customer and that also entails learning what their particular warranties are. This is not something that is obviously part of the fence, but it sure can play an important part if there's a problem, but this is like most other products where there usually is a warranty from the manufacturer.
